Witryna7 cze 2024 · 操作符.txt . View code About. Linux commonly used commands Stars. 0 stars Watchers. 1 watching Forks. 0 forks Report repository Releases No releases published. Packages 0. No packages published . Footer ... You signed in with another tab or window. Reload to refresh your session. Witryna6 kwi 2024 · 运算符不会计算其右操作数。 仅当左操作数的计算结果为 null 时,Null 合并赋值运算符 ??= 才会将其右操作数的值赋值给其左操作数。 如果左操作数的计算结果为非 null,则 ??= 运算符不会计算其右操作数。 C# List numbers = null; int? a = null; Console.WriteLine ( (numbers is null)); // expected: true // if numbers is null, initialize it.
JavaScript中的new操作符的原理解析 - CSDN博客
Witryna一般的new运算符负责在heap堆中找到一个足以能够满足要求的内存块。 new运算符还有另一种变体:定位new运算符 (placement new),它能够在分配内存时指定内存的位置。 定位new运算符在头文件中。 WitrynaEdit: to expand on my territory tier idea.. There's 11 territories. Make 4 of them tier 1 (Everfall, Windsward, Mourningdale, Monarchs). Make 5 of them tier 2. Make 2 of … tonovani vlasu
GitHub - harvestlamb/Cpp_houjie: 侯捷C++课程PPT及代码,动手学 …
Witryna可以肯定的是,“new Person ()”返回的是实例对象的内存空间首地址,可以打印出来的。 new作为一个优先级很高的运算符,它的结合性是从右到左,这里它操作的是Person类的构造方法。 好,让我们回到构造方法的定义。 “构造方法是一类特殊的方法,它的名字必须与类名完全相同,且不返回任何数据类型,不能有任何非访问性质的修饰符,也不 … Witrynanew / delete 操作符的作用域 如果使用某个类的成员函数来重载这些运算符,则意味着这些运算符仅针对该特定类才被重载。 如 果重载是在类外完成的(即它不是类的成员函数),则只要您使用这些运算符 (在类内或类外),都将调用重载的“ new”和“ delete”。 这是全局超载。 以下是new操作符函数的原型 void* operator new(size_t size); 以下 … Witryna19 lis 2024 · 在JS中,new操作符是用来通过构造函数来创建一个实例对象的。例如: function Foo(name){ this.name = name; } let foo = new Foo('zhangsan'); … tonovi boja prvi razred